Ivan Swinburne

Ivan Archie Swinburne CMG (6 March 1908 – 12 August 1994) was an Australian politician.

He was born in Wangaratta, Victoria, to dairy farmers George Arthur and Hilda Maud Swinburne.

From 1940 to 1947, he was a member of Bright Shire Council, serving as president from 1943 to 1944.

Swinburne was elected to the Victorian Legislative Council in 1946 for North Eastern Province as a Country Party member.
